Is Amy Adams Irish?

Amy Adams ancestry

Amy Adams was born to American parents—her father, Richard Adams, was a U.S. Army serviceman stationed in Italy at the time of her birth. According to Britannica, her ancestry includes Irish, English, and German roots, specifically from her father’s side. However, the precise proportions are not documented in any verified genealogical record.

Where was Amy Adams born?

She was born in Vicenza, Italy, on August 20, 1974. Her family moved frequently due to her father’s military career, and she was raised primarily in Castle Rock, Colorado, after her parents’ divorce when she was 11, according to multiple Wikipedia summaries (German Wikipedia, Polish Wikipedia).

Does Amy Adams have any children?

How old was Amy Adams when she gave birth?

Adams gave birth to her only child, a daughter named Aviana Olea Le Gallo, on May 15, 2010 (Simple English Wikipedia). She was 35 years old at the time. Aviana’s father is Darren Le Gallo, an artist and actor whom Adams married in 2015.

Amy Adams family details

Beyond her immediate family, Adams is one of seven children—a fact noted across multiple Wikipedia pages, though the exact sibling names and occupations are not centrally documented. Her father, Richard, worked as a restaurant manager after leaving the military; her mother, Kathryn Hicken, was a semi-professional bodybuilder and later a homemaker (Biography.com).

Is Amy Adams related to Nicole Kidman?

Amy Adams family tree

Despite persistent internet speculation, Amy Adams and Nicole Kidman are not related by blood or marriage. The rumor likely stems from their collaborations: they co-starred in Paul Thomas Anderson’s The Master (2012) and Tom Ford’s Nocturnal Animals (2016). Both are fair-skinned, red-haired actresses of Irish descent, which may also fuel the confusion. However, no credible genealogical source connects their family trees.

Amy Adams The Office appearance

Yes—Adams guest-starred on The Office in 2005 as Katy Moore, a purse saleswoman who briefly dates Jim Halpert (John Krasinski). The role came just before her Junebug breakout and is a fun footnote for fans who recognize her from the show’s early seasons. The episode, “Hot Girl,” aired in 2005 (IMDb).
